本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,企业对于IT基础设施的要求越来越高,负载均衡作为一种有效的资源分配和优化手段,在保障系统稳定性和提升用户体验方面发挥着重要作用,本文将深入解析负载均衡参数,探讨关键要素及其优化策略。
负载均衡参数概述
1、负载均衡算法
负载均衡算法是负载均衡的核心,它决定了如何将请求分配到各个节点,常见的负载均衡算法有:
(1)轮询(Round Robin):按照顺序将请求分配到各个节点。
(2)最少连接(Least Connections):将请求分配到连接数最少的节点。
(3)源IP哈希(Source IP Hash):根据客户端的IP地址进行哈希,将请求分配到对应的节点。
(4)URL哈希(URL Hash):根据请求的URL进行哈希,将请求分配到对应的节点。
2、负载均衡策略
负载均衡策略是指如何实现负载均衡算法,主要包括以下几种:
(1)DNS轮询:通过修改DNS记录实现负载均衡。
(2)反向代理:通过反向代理服务器实现负载均衡。
(3)四层负载均衡:在传输层(TCP/UDP)实现负载均衡。
(4)七层负载均衡:在应用层(HTTP/HTTPS)实现负载均衡。
图片来源于网络,如有侵权联系删除
3、负载均衡阈值
负载均衡阈值是指系统所能承受的最大负载,当超过阈值时,系统可能会出现性能下降、响应时间延长等问题,常见的负载均衡阈值包括:
(1)并发连接数:系统同时处理的连接数。
(2)请求处理能力:系统每秒处理的请求数。
(3)系统资源使用率:如CPU、内存、磁盘等。
关键要素解析
1、网络带宽
网络带宽是影响负载均衡性能的重要因素,为了保证负载均衡效果,需要确保网络带宽足够大,以应对高并发请求。
2、节点性能
节点性能是指负载均衡系统中各个节点的处理能力,为了保证系统稳定运行,需要选择性能优良的节点。
3、负载均衡设备
负载均衡设备是实现负载均衡的关键硬件,常见的负载均衡设备有硬件负载均衡器、软件负载均衡器等。
4、监控与告警
监控与告警是保障负载均衡系统稳定运行的重要手段,通过实时监控系统运行状态,及时发现并处理异常情况。
图片来源于网络,如有侵权联系删除
优化策略
1、选择合适的负载均衡算法
根据业务需求和系统特点,选择合适的负载均衡算法,如对于需要保证请求一致性的场景,可以选择源IP哈希算法。
2、合理配置负载均衡阈值
根据系统性能和业务需求,合理配置负载均衡阈值,避免系统过载。
3、优化网络配置
优化网络配置,如调整TCP参数、优化路由策略等,以提高网络传输效率。
4、选择高性能负载均衡设备
选择性能优良的负载均衡设备,以保证系统稳定运行。
5、实施监控与告警
建立完善的监控与告警体系,实时监控系统运行状态,及时发现并处理异常情况。
负载均衡参数是保障系统稳定性和提升用户体验的关键,通过对负载均衡参数的深入解析,我们可以更好地优化系统性能,提高用户体验,在实际应用中,需要根据业务需求和系统特点,合理配置负载均衡参数,以达到最佳效果。
标签: #负载均衡参数详解
评论列表